The following ideas will help council efforts to tackle the plastic bag problem:

  • first off, councils can work with local community groups, retailers and the media to ensure that your community is ready for a plastic bag phase-out
  • give away reusable bags and paper bags in your community - councils and community groups have given away over a million reusable bags and paper bags in recent years
  • get your Mayor or council Recycling Officer to front a local community campaign to get rid of plastic bags. Make them the community 'face' of your initative and get other well known locals to help out too
  • design a poster for your community that can be put up in local retail outlets
  • run an ongoing campaign in partnership with your local newspaper - get readers to send in their own tips for living without plastic checkout-style bags
  • do a 'Coles Bay' and get your local community and retailers to go plastic checkout bag free.
